Solution Overview

Problem

Ensuring backwards-compatibility with legacy devices in VoLTE communication sessions is challenging, particularly regarding local ringing tone generation and compatibility with fixed SIP phones.

Innovation Solution

The introduction of a modified SIP response message with additional data, such as a Combined User-Agent header, that includes information about the calling and called devices, allowing network entities to take remedial action without querying external databases.

AI summary

The disclosure relates to a method for facilitating a communication session between a calling device (101) and a called device (102). The method comprises generating, by a first entity (103a), a modified SIP response including additional data. The modified SIP response is a response to a SIP request made by the calling device (101). The additional data comprises an indication of at least one characteristic of at least one of the calling device (101) and the called device (102). The method further comprises receiving, at a second entity (103b), the modified SIP response. The method also comprises applying, by the second entity (103b), one or more rules to the modified SIP response based on the additional data.
